President Trump is expected to issue a pardon to former Illinois Gov. Rod Blagojevich, almost exactly five years after he commuted the Democrat’s 14-year sentence on federal corruption charges, The Post has learned. It was unclear when the pardon would be issued to Blagojevich, 68. The plan was first reported by Axios. Former Illinois governor and…
